IRRIGATION-WATER USE EFFICIENCY
The
irrigation-water use efficiency with the present method of furrow/flood
irrigation followed by the farmers is very low. There is excessive use of
irrigation water with this method resulting in high leaching losses of water and
also of the nutrients particularly that of nitrogen along with water. In this
method, it is always advisable to apply light and frequent irrigations rather
than a few heavy irrigations. The water use efficiency can be improved with the
other two methods viz. the sprinkler and drip/trickle irrigation. In areas
having limited irrigation water, these two methods can be used and where the
land topography is undulating, sprinkler irrigation has proved more useful.
Adoption of plasticulture also helps in conserving moisture and reducing
irrigation requirements greatly. This technology is being used extensively in
countries like China and can also be adopted in India in areas having limited
irrigation water availability.
